引言
随着互联网技术的不断发展,Web开发领域也在不断进步。JavaServer Pages(JSP)作为一种流行的服务器端技术,在Web开发中扮演着重要角色。而前端框架则在前端开发中起到了至关重要的作用,它可以帮助开发者提高开发效率,提升用户体验。本文将揭秘JSP前端框架,探讨如何利用这些框架轻松提升网页开发效率。
JSP前端框架概述
JSP前端框架主要指的是在JSP页面中使用的JavaScript框架,它们可以帮助开发者简化前端开发流程,提高开发效率。以下是一些常见的JSP前端框架:
- ExtJS:ExtJS是一款功能丰富的JavaScript UI库,提供大量组件,如表格、面板、表单、菜单等,支持响应式布局,适用于移动和桌面应用。
- jQuery:jQuery是一个快速、小型且功能丰富的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ax操作。
- Bootstrap:Bootstrap是一个流行的前端框架,提供了一系列的CSS和JavaScript组件,用于快速开发响应式、移动优先的网站。
- AngularJS:AngularJS是一个由Google维护的JavaScript框架,用于构建单页应用程序(SPA),具有双向数据绑定、模块化等特点。
利用JSP前端框架提升开发效率
1. 提高代码复用性
前端框架通常提供大量可复用的组件和库,开发者可以轻松地引入和使用这些组件,从而减少重复劳动,提高开发效率。
2. 简化开发流程
前端框架提供了一套完整的解决方案,包括布局、样式、动画等,开发者只需关注业务逻辑,无需花费大量时间在底层实现上。
3. 提升用户体验
前端框架支持响应式布局,可以确保网页在不同设备上都能良好展示,从而提升用户体验。
4. 提高团队协作效率
前端框架具有模块化、组件化的特点,便于团队成员分工合作,提高团队协作效率。
5. 代码维护和扩展性
前端框架具有良好的代码组织结构和规范,便于后期维护和扩展。
实例分析
以下是一个使用jQuery框架的简单示例:
<!DOCTYPE html>
<html>
<head>
<title>jQuery示例</title>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script>
$(document).ready(function(){
$("#clickMe").click(function(){
$("#text").hide();
});
});
</script>
</head>
<body>
<h2>jQuery示例</h2>
<p id="text">这是一个使用jQuery的示例。</p>
<button id="clickMe">点击我</button>
</body>
</html>
在这个示例中,我们使用jQuery来实现一个简单的点击隐藏文本的功能。通过引入jQuery库,我们可以轻松地实现这个功能,而无需编写复杂的JavaScript代码。
总结
JSP前端框架为开发者提供了丰富的工具和资源,有助于提高网页开发效率。通过合理选择和使用这些框架,开发者可以更快地完成项目,提升用户体验,提高团队协作效率。